The V.League 1, as it is known today, began in 1980 when the first All Vietnam Football Championship was launched. If the V.League 1 champions also won the Vietnamese Cup, then the league runners-up provide the opposition. [1] The fixture was first played in the 1998–99 season. The current holders are V.League 1 winners Thep Xanh Nam Dinh, who defeated runner-ups Dong A Thanh Hoa 3–0 in the 2024 match. [2]
The 2023 V.League 1, known as the Night Wolf V.League 1 (Vietnamese: Giải bóng đá Vô địch Quốc gia Night Wolf 2023) for sponsorship reasons, was the 40th season of the V.League 1, the highest division of Vietnamese football and the 23rd as a professional league. [1] The season started on 3 February 2023. [2]
The Super Cup is the first game of the season, played between the previous years' winners of the V.League 1 and National Cup. If the same team wins both competition, then the team finishing second in the previous years' V.League 1 take on the V.League 1 winners.

The 2022 V.League 1, known as the Night Wolf V.League 1 (Vietnamese: Giải bóng đá Vô địch Quốc gia Night Wolf 2022) for sponsorship reasons, was the 39th season of the V.League 1, the highest division of Vietnamese football and the 22nd as a professional league. [1] The season started on 25 February 2022, and ended on 20 November. [2]
